What is Pranayama and what are the benefits?
Pranayama is often used in yoga or meditation practices and means Prana (life force energy) and Ayama (extension and control) therefore it uses various techniques including alternate nostril breathing,bellows breath and balancing breath to control the Prana energy through the breath, connecting the mind with the body.
The breath is inhaled, held and then slowly exhaled in a controlled way and anyone can do it, including children if they can be patient enough!
The benefits of Pranayama include :
Increased clarity
Reduction in Stress
Increased energy
Lowered blood pressure
Improved digestion
Improved Sleep
Increased Immunity
